NEW YORK, NY.- Celebrated musician and artist Les Claypool, in collaboration with YellowHeart, the NFT marketplace for music, ticketing and community tokens which accepts both crypto and credit card payments, announced today an exclusive and innovative new audio, visual NFT series called “Pulsating Poetry Paintings.” Claypool, who is widely regarded for his wildly inventive musical style, delved into new artistic mediums during the pandemic, creating distinctive new pieces that will thrill fans who have an appetite for innovative arts.

The series is an episodic experience crafted from the "bent noir," acrylic paintings on canvas by Les Claypool. Each painting is animated to a new original song. The collection will evolve into a full original Les Claypool album and art collection as the series is released, with each piece produced and animated by Les’ son and visual artist Cage Claypool. Each video moment has accompanying bonus downloadable content including a HI-RES of the video, Wav file of the music and the original painting. The blending of traditional mediums with a digital format will offer a truly unique artisan NFT experience, providing many layers for fans to peel back, discover and enjoy the evolving visual album experience by Les Claypool.

The first video artwork piece in the NFT collection entitled “Self Within Him Self” is now available for purchase.

“During this last year of craziness, I found it difficult to get motivated to create music for the first time in 30 years. I instead opted to spend the summer on my John Deere 35D excavator busting dirt and clearing fire trails from our land around Rancho Relaxo. The result was not just a movement of earth and foliage but also a cathartic sweep of dust and cobwebs from my cluttered and confused cranium,” said Les Claypool. “It was soon after that I found solace in putting brush to canvas. Having accumulated a collection of imagery that reflected my taste for classic film as well as black velvet paintings, I then heard of this new conduit for art called NFT's. Confused by the notion, I just put my own twist on this medium. I call them Pulsating Poetry Paintings, another form of PPP for the Covid age.”

“Les Claypool is not only known as one of the greatest bass players of all time through his legendary work with Primus and Oysterhead, but also an artistic visionary who has the rare ability to create high art through every medium he touches,” said Josh Katz, CEO and founder of YellowHeart. “Through the unbridled power of NFTs and blockchain technology, Les now has the ability to take all of his artistic, musical and creative output and release it directly to his fans. With new music, amazing original art, and ARG, Les is a perfect example of an artist who can push the perceived norms of creative boundaries and create a collection that is as dynamic as it is fun.”
